If Bravo (or, Lord help us, Fox) were to stop with the dancing/singing/modeling competitions and focus on something more relevant to this modern world—So You Think You Can Multitask?, let's say—Martin Dosh would destroy the competition.

Why? After growing up the son of the most rebellious rebels possible (when they met and fell in love, his father was a Catholic priest and his mother was well on her way to nunhood), Dosh's experimental nature led him first to keyboards and drums, then to samplers and looping pedals, then to following the Dead.


All of this culminated in the Minneapolis-based multi-instrumentalist eventually building a home studio, where he constructs his wordless, layered songs, often with regular Dosh co-conspirator Mike Lewis. Courtesy of Anticon, watch the two of them record "Capture the Flag," the final track from the groovy and awesome Wolves and Wishes, Dosh's just-unleashed fourth LP:




Dosh is currently wrapping up a short jaunt around the U.S. with Anathallo. Before the tour ends, he'll play First Avenue with fellow Minneapolitan P.O.S. and reunite with his loopmaster collaborator Andrew Bird in Colorado.
